Output 87e271029faf553922bccd08b1d069623553b6bc157a9399642d4f5db29c781e:1

value
51154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f42146052c9f54d0c3c2813db55492abb4958e OP_EQUAL
address
34hG18WiQiaAwqvYnVuQVrqDbhvJsDfX7c
transaction
87e271029faf553922bccd08b1d069623553b6bc157a9399642d4f5db29c781e
confirmations
364417
spent
true